How to roll back an update - boot failure
Posted by Darin on March 3rd, 2004


I just installed several critical updates to my Windows
2000 installation. Now I cannot boot. During the boot
process (safe, debugging, normal...) my machine reboots
itself again just as the progress bar on the Windows 2000
splash screen reaches the end. That puts it into an
endless reboot cycle.

How can I roll back this update?

Which update did you install? Can you boot info Safe Mode?

Restart your computer in Safe Mode:

a. Restart the computer.

b. Press F8 for advanced startup options.

c. Choose Safe Mode and press ENTER.
